#360998 Fish Dying... Again

Posted by sandgroper on 09 April 2017 - 12:51 PM in Fish Health, Nutrition, Diseases & Pests

That's interesting Mike as my 1kg jar differs.

Chlorine use 5g (1tsp) to each 750L (200 gallons) of tap water (removes 4 ppm)

Chloramine use 5g (1tsp) to each 950L (250 gallons) of tap water (removes 4 ppm)

Ammonia use 5g (1tsp) to each 150 L (40 gallons) of tap water (removes 4 ppm)

I will add that i've been using Safe at this level (1/4 - 1/5) or tip of a teaspoon for over 12years with out any dramas. It would be good though if someone in the know could tell us why the two bottle directions differ. It would be better if i could use less, then it would last many more years longer.
